Is Roblox Tax 40%?

Many Roblox users ask: Is Roblox tax 40% or 30%?
The official fee is 30%, but some users perceive it as higher due to additional factors.

Roblox Tax Calculator Example Showing 30% Marketplace Fee


Official Roblox Tax Rate

Roblox charges a 30% marketplace fee on every item or gamepass sale:

  • Sell an item for 100 Robux
  • Roblox takes 30 Robux
  • You receive 70 Robux

Why Some Players Think It’s 40%

Factors increasing perceived deductions:

  1. Currency Conversion: DevEx conversion reduces your USD payout.
  2. Premium Payouts: Engagement-based earnings vary.
  3. Group Sales or Promotions: Additional deductions may apply.

Thus, the “40% tax” perception comes from extra reductions, not the official fee.

FAQ

Does Roblox Take 30 Percent?

Yes, the official marketplace fee is 30%.

Why Does Roblox Have a 30% Tax?

It supports servers, moderation, and platform maintenance.

Is Roblox Premium Tax Different?

Premium payouts depend on engagement and are calculated separately.
